World Cat 270 TE: BoatTEST Review

Reviewed by Jeff Hammond

Overview

The WorldCat 270 Tournament Edition, introduced in Beaufort, North Carolina through a collaboration with Honda, is a refined center console boat designed specifically for serious anglers. This 28-foot vessel combines tournament-ready fishing capabilities with enhanced creature comforts, making it suitable for offshore fishing, striper trail excursions, and SKA tournaments. The 270TE balances the features of a larger boat with the convenience of trailerability, offering anglers a versatile and efficient platform.

Exterior Design and Fishing Features

The 270 Tournament Edition features a spacious forward-raised casting deck equipped with low-profile rails and stainless steel rod holders integrated into the gunnels. Large storage lockers in the bow utilize stainless steel-assisted struts for easy access when retrieving lines. An optional anchor windlass is available to aid in anchoring. Each corner of the bow is outfitted with electrical outlets for trolling gear, speakers, and courtesy lights, enhancing functionality during fishing operations. Full bolsters provide comfort when leaning into the fight with fish, complemented by ample toe-kick space beneath the gunnels. The boat includes a massive 288-quart coffin fishbox that doubles as a forward seat, flanked by two additional double-insulated 240-quart fish lockers on either side of the center console, now with added access lockers. Rod storage is thoughtfully integrated with a rack beneath the gunnels and removable rod racks inside the fish lockers. The tip-out four-box tackle center and an additional tackle center mounted beside the helm provide organized storage for fishing gear.

Helm and Deck Layout

The helm station is designed for ergonomic efficiency and ease of use, featuring a covered electronics panel with Honda instrumentation. To the left of the stainless steel steering wheel are the stereo remote and windlass switch, while soft-touch power switches are arranged to the right. A flip-down footrest and battery control panel are positioned below the wheel. The leaning post seat includes four rod holders and a grab rail, with a tool and tackle center mounted on its rear and battery access beneath. A coiled hose is conveniently stored at the end of the leaning post, accompanied by a raw water/fresh water selector valve. The optional fiberglass hardtop adds zippered storage, an electronics box above the helm, and a dome light with white and red settings, including a switch for spreader lights mounted on the rear of the hardtop. The stern area is equipped with six rod holders, electrical connections in each corner, and 31-gallon bait wells located in each corner of the transom. Access to the engines and water is facilitated by a drop-down stern door and an optional ladder system.

Engine and Performance

Powering the 270 Tournament Edition is Honda's BF225 4-stroke outboard engine, recognized for its high performance and efficiency. This engine shares technology with Honda's automotive models such as the Odyssey and Pilot. It features a two-stage air induction system that draws fresh air from the top and channels it through long intakes to a butterfly valve that opens at 4,000 RPM, optimizing air intake for both low and high-speed operation. Maintenance is simplified with an easily accessible oil fill located beneath the alternator and near the starter, along with a spin-on automotive oil filter. The 270TE measures 28 feet in length overall with a beam of 8 feet 6 inches and weighs approximately 4,200 pounds. Economical cruising occurs at 3,000 RPM, achieving 24.7 miles per hour and a range of 315 miles. At top speed, the boat runs 49.2 miles per hour at 5,650 RPM, offering a range of 173 miles.

Additional Features and Summary

Additional practical features include a chart tube and port-a-potty storage beneath the helm, as well as a water tank located aft. Fuel water separators are discreetly positioned behind a cover in the gunwale. The recent updates to the 270 Tournament Edition, particularly the addition of the hardtop and enhanced livewell capacity, have significantly improved both comfort and fishability. These enhancements, combined with the boat's robust fishing amenities and reliable Honda powerplant, make the 270TE a highly capable and comfortable tournament fishing vessel.
